  • Francis Peabody Magoun, Jr.
  • MC (6 January 1895 – 5 June 1979) was one of the seminal figures in the study of medieval and English literature in the 20th century, a scholar of subjects as varied as soccer and ancient Germanic naming practices, and translator of numerous important texts.
  • Though an American, he served in the British Royal Flying Corps (later Royal Air Force) as a lieutenant during World War I.
  • Magoun was one of several Americans that served in Britain's No.
  • 1 Squadron RAF, and was one of three Americans in that squadron to achieve 5 or more aerial victories.
  • Magoun was victor in five aerial combats and was also decorated with Britain's Military Cross for gallantry.
